In July of 2019, NOAA broke. It seems that for some reason, they briefly lost their TTS license, and as a result, demo messages were all over the weather forecasts in several states for a few hours. Here's a recording of this from station KEC-63 in Southfield, MI.

Been working on a few improvements to the #pixelfedApp!

Some highlights:
✨ Captions preserve newlines
✨ Fixed caption mentions
✨ Caption urls are now rendered and open in-app or in browser
✨ Improved interactions (liked by & shared by)
✨ Comments w/media
✨ Improved comment threading
✨ Improved bio rendering
✨ More relevant search results
✨ Fixed search bar to support pasting
✨ Tap Home to scroll to top of feed
✨ Long press avatar to switch accounts

And more! Shipping soon 🚀
